Streaming Movies or TVA 1080p HD 30 fps 2-hour movie averages 3 GB in file size. A 720p HD 2-hour movie averages 2 GB in file size. A Standard Definition (SD) 2-hour movie averages 1 GB in file size.

This statistic displays the average monthly smartphone cellular data usage from 2016 to 2021. In 2016, on average a smartphone consumed 1.7 GBs of cellular data per month. That number is projected to reach 8.9 GBs in 2021.What uses the most data on cell phone?
Activities that use a lot of data
- High definition video streaming (900MB per hour)
- Video conferencing, like FaceTime® and Skype® (480MB per hour)
- Standard-definition video streaming (240MB per hour)
- Online interactive gaming (60MB per hour)
- Streaming music (30MB per hour)
- Downloading movies and large data files.
